When one celestial body blocks the light from another, it is called an eclipse. In a solar eclipse, the Moon passes between the Earth and the Sun, obscuring the Sun's light. Conversely, in a lunar eclipse, the Earth blocks sunlight from reaching the Moon. Eclipses can provide valuable insights into astronomical phenomena and the positions of celestial bodies.

This phenomenon is known as an occultation, where a celestial body passes in front of and blocks the light from another body, such as a planet or star. It can be used to study the atmosphere, structure, and characteristics of both objects involved. Scientists can measure the timing, duration, and changes in light during occultations to gather valuable information about the bodies involved.

When the moon blocks the sun's light, or the Earth blocks the light from the sun that strikes the moon, it's called an eclipse. For an arbitrary body passing in front of another one, the term astronomers usually use is "occultation".
